Rwandans and other Africans, Don’t Miss Fully Funded UK Government Chevening Scholarship!

Yevheniia Sebahire by Yevheniia Sebahire
October 9, 2024
0
412
VIEWS

The UK Government Chevening Scholarship 2025-2026 offers a unique opportunity for Africans, including Rwandans, to pursue a fully funded master’s degree at any UK university. This prestigious scholarship covers tuition fees, monthly living expenses, return flights, and additional costs, making it a dream come true for aspiring leaders.

Chevening aims to develop future world leaders by providing them with access to top-notch education, a chance to network globally, and the opportunity to experience UK culture. Funded by the UK’s Foreign and Commonwealth Office and partner organizations, Chevening is a competitive scholarship, with around 1,500 awards available worldwide.

What Does the Chevening Scholarship Cover?

  • Full tuition fees for a UK university.
  • A monthly living allowance.
  • Economy-class flights to and from the UK.
  • Visa costs and allowances for arrival and departure.
  • Travel grants for attending Chevening events.

How to Apply:

  1. Select your country on the Chevening website and create an account.
  2. Fill in your profile with personal information and validate your application.
  3. Complete the quiz to check your eligibility.
  4. Submit all required documents including education transcripts, an English language certificate, course offers, references, and a passport or ID.

Application Deadline: November 5, 2024.
